TiVo in trouble?

(Click here to view the original thread with full colors/images)



Posted by: Morf

I've been a TiVo user for several months now, and absolutely love it. Everyone I've shown it to has been impressed. However, today a co-worker who is interested in buying a unit expressed concern about TiVo's future. A friend of his claimed that TiVo was in risk of going bankrupt and closing any time now.

Needless to say, this scared the crap out of me.

I immediately scoured the net for any news stories I could find about TiVo's financial status, but all I could find were articles from the middle of 2001, mentioning TiVo's possible financial problems, but nothing more.

Can anyone help provide more information? Is TiVo near the end?

Posted by: mtchamp

Join The Motley Fool where there is a message board of investors and get all the company financials and stock talk you need. TiVo the company is doing fine.

There is always someone looking for an excuse not to buy or ready to criticize someone else's purchase. The most common excuses from the elite naysayers are I don't watch much TV and they know what I'll be watching.

Enjoy your TiVo. I've had mine for over 2 years and feel pretty smart. TiVo is on the path to doubling subscribers to one million within 9 months with the launch of DirecTV's Series2 Digital Satellite Recorder Powered by TiVo.

Don't worry about a thing. TiVo's name brand, superior technology and patents are quite valuable and would be sold to another company if anything.
